01 Bonn: Bundestag debate on the German-Allied contracts breakdown from new German newsreels 150/1: Government Bank, total. Grandstand for spectators and cameramen. Erich Ollenhauer at the lectern, half-close. (Rejection of the German Allied contracts), no original sound. Erhard and Schäffer as a listener, great. Kurt Kiesinger speaks for the CDU (no original sound. Adenauer actuality. Intermediate cuts: Government Bank, audience, great.) Deputies clapping. Bundestag President Ehlers during the vote (assuming the contracts with 218:164 votes). O Adenauer: "I ask you, ladies and gentlemen of the opposition, I would ask you herDie time under the Lupeichst and urgently: check, check for me with all sharpness, but I ask you to remember what is at stake." And the German people within and beyond the iron curtain need to know what is at stake. It is for these contracts to his freedom, his life, the future of his children and grandchildren. I call on the whole German people to be aware of the significance of this decision and to stay conscious. It is the fateful question of Germany. We are faced with the choice between slavery and freedom. We choose freedom."
(52 m) 02 Seoul: Eisenhower in South Korea transparent welcome President Eisenhower. Billboard with portrait of Eisenhower, great. Two new South Korean divisions are set up and receive their emblems in the presence of President Syngman Rhee and General van fleet. A wreath of flowers is to put General van fleet.
(16 m) 03. Schleswig-Holstein: oil drilling rigs between Neumünster and Plön. Drill master opens valve. Output of natural gas, oil runs out. Oil pipelines be laid over meadows. Shield: DEA first crude oil out of the hole of Plön 2. rail tankers are filled.
